Ciara Smyth
Born in the south of Ireland but now resident in Belfast, Smyth worked as a teacher and mental health trainer before becoming a social worker. Alongside her day job she wrote her debut YA novel The Falling in Love Montage (2020), a delightfully witty queer romantic comedy set during the long hot summer between the end of school and the start of university. The Falling in Love Montage won the Junior Juries category of the KPMG Children’s Book Ireland Awards in 2021 and was followed in 2021 by Not My Problem, which was shortlisted for the 2022 Waterstones Children’s Book Prize.
